(NH4)1.67Zn1.67Al2.33P4O16 ([NH4]0.83Zn0.83Al1.17[PO4]2) Crystal Structure
General Information
- Phase Label(s): [NH4]0.83Zn0.83Al1.17[PO4]2
- Structure Class(es): –
- Classification by Properties: –
- Mineral Name(s): –
- Pearson Symbol: mS104
- Space Group: 15
- Phase Prototype: SrGa2[SiO4]2
- Measurement Detail(s): automatic diffractometer; 3775 (determination of cell parameters), automatic diffractometer; Bruker AXS SMART (determination of structural parameters), X-rays, Mo Kα; λ = 0.071073 nm (determination of cell and structural parameters)
- Phase Class(es): –
- Compound Class(es): orthophosphate
- Interpretation Detail(s): complete structure determined, full-matrix least-squares refinement; 131 variables; 1660 reflections; I > 2σ(I), R = 0.0527; wR = 0.1135
- Sample Detail(s): sample prepared from H3PO4, Zn(CH3COO)2, pseudoboehmite, 1,3-propane diamine, inductive coupled plasma method; Al/Zn/P ratio 2.15/1.61/4; 9.59 wt.% Al, 17.38 wt.% Zn, 20.49 wt.% P, single crystal (determination of cell parameters), single crystal, 0.10×0.14×0.18 mm3 (determination of structural parameters)
Substance Summary
- Standard Formula: [NH4]0.83Zn0.83Al1.17[PO4]2
- Alphabetic Formula: Al1.17[NH4]0.83[PO4]2Zn0.83
- Published Formula: (NH4)1.67Zn1.67Al2.33P4O16
- Refined Formula: Al1.17H3.32N0.83O8P2Zn0.83
- Wyckoff Sequence: 15,f13
- Z Formula Units: 8
- Density: ρ = 2.39 Mg·m−3
